This is easy to do if your phone is rooted, and requires no modification to any boot animation or anything.
Open a root explorer, go to /system/media/audio/ui.
Rename the following two files as shown below (not mandatory for the names to match mine, they are just for example)
PowerOn.ogg -> PowerOn.ogg.disabled
PowerOff.ogg -> PowerOff.ogg.disabled
From here, you can also get rid of camera and other annoying sounds from the phones UI.
Hope this helps answer your question, but there is no non-root method that guarantees silence.

Not sure if this is the same on GS3 but on the GS I just read, and altered, the system volume in the sounds setup. Go to your Setup and choose Sounds, then choose Volume and slide the system volume all the say down. All other sounds still work but that one is gone!
